PERMANENT AND CASUAL ROLES AVAILABLE

For permanent Passenger Assistants, your contract will be anything between 10 to 16 hours depending on journey.  The hours for casual Passenger Assistants vary each week, and are dependent on service needs and your availability.

You will be asked to work anytime between the hours of 7.15am to 9.30am and 2.30pm to 5.30pm in any one day you could work all or up to these hours.

You will ensure that a high quality passenger transport service is delivered to our customers. By assisting passengers and attending to their personal, physical and medical needs, assisting drivers and contributing to a safe and efficient Transport Service.

You will be required to work on any route within Kirklees, and can be transferred to an alternative route at short notice to meet the needs of the service.

You should have experience of being a carer for children or adults and experience of working with people who have a disability. You should hold a First Aid certificate or be willing to undergo training.
